Abstract

A packaging assembly for kitchen appliances comprises an outer packaging box (1), a lower cushion block (2) and an upper cushion block (3), wherein a containing space for containing a kitchen appliance (4) is formed between the upper cushion block and the lower cushion block; the kitchen appliance (4) comprises a shell (41), wherein the front side of the shell (41) is provided with an opening and is provided with at least two door bodies (42) which are distributed up and down and used for opening and closing the opening; the door is characterized by further comprising a middle cushion block (5) positioned between the upper cushion block and the lower cushion block, wherein the inner side surface of the middle cushion block (5) is provided with a groove (51) which can allow at least adjacent parts of two adjacent door bodies (42) to be inserted into the groove at the same time. This application can effectively protect two at least door bodies, reduces the impaired risk of door body.

Packaging assembly for kitchen appliance
Technical Field
The invention belongs to the technical field of packaging, and particularly relates to a packaging assembly for kitchen appliances.
Background
Kitchen appliances are mostly box-type structures like a disinfection cabinet, an electric steamer, an electric oven, a refrigerator and the like, and comprise a shell, wherein a cavity is arranged in the shell, and a door body for opening and closing the cavity is arranged on the front side of the shell.
At present, the packaging structure of these kitchen appliances is referred to as a packaging structure of an oven range of utility model patent No. ZL201720738584.1 (publication No. CN207029977U), which includes a first packaging member for being installed at the top of the oven range, a second packaging member for being installed at the bottom of the oven range, a third packaging member for being installed at the front of the oven range, and a packing box assembly for placing a range cover and a frame of the oven range and being installed at the front of the oven range. For example, the packaging structure of microwave oven of the invention patent application No. CN201110380307.5 (application publication No. CN103129855A), includes a top cover, which is disposed on the top of the microwave oven and made of a foaming material, and the periphery of the top cover forms a side wall surrounding the upper part of the microwave oven; a base seat which is arranged at the bottom of the microwave oven and is made of foaming material, the periphery of the base seat forms a side wall surrounding the lower part of the microwave oven, and the top cover and the base seat are of an integrated structure; the supporting columns at corresponding positions between the top cover and the base are respectively communicated with each other, and the whole microwave oven is enclosed between the top cover and the base.
The door body among the above-mentioned kitchen appliance all has only one, to the multi-door electric appliance of a little upper and lower door body structure, like three-door refrigerator, two door sterilizer etc, also adopt the structure of upper and lower cushion packing among the prior art more, on, the bottom that the bottom door body was located the top of the door body of the top and was located the below can be lived to the ability parcel of lower cushion, but can not play limiting displacement to the door body in the middle of being located and the adjacent part of two adjacent door bodies, and then the door body that leads to these positions appears the door body condition of door body unevenness or even door body breakage in the transportation.
Disclosure of Invention
The first technical problem to be solved by the present invention is to provide a packaging assembly for kitchen appliances, which can effectively protect a door body and reduce the risk of damage to the door body under the condition that at least two door bodies are distributed up and down, aiming at the current situation of the prior art.
A second technical problem to be solved by the present invention is to provide a packaging assembly for kitchen appliances, which improves the supporting strength and prevents the housing from being damaged, in view of the current situation of the prior art.
The technical scheme adopted by the invention for solving the first technical problem is as follows: a packaging assembly for kitchen appliances comprises an outer packaging box and an inner packaging assembly accommodated in the outer packaging box, wherein the inner packaging assembly comprises a lower cushion block and an upper cushion block positioned above the lower cushion block, and an accommodating space for accommodating the kitchen appliances is formed between the upper cushion block and the lower cushion block; the kitchen appliance comprises a shell, wherein the front side of the shell is open and provided with at least two door bodies which are distributed up and down and used for opening and closing the opening; the top surface of the lower cushion block is provided with a first door body clamping groove which can accommodate the bottom surface of the door body positioned at the lowest position to be inserted into the first door body clamping groove, and the bottom surface of the upper cushion block is provided with a second door body clamping groove which can accommodate the top surface of the door body positioned at the highest position to be inserted into the second door body clamping groove;
the door body structure is characterized by further comprising a middle cushion block positioned between the upper cushion block and the lower cushion block, wherein the inner side surface of the middle cushion block is provided with a groove which can allow at least adjacent parts of two adjacent door bodies to be inserted into the groove at the same time.
The middle cushion block can be a block and is integrally U-shaped, and the door body is surrounded from the front side of the door body. In order to reduce the quantity of package material and protect the door body better in this application, it is preferred, correspond same two adjacent door bodies the middle cushion divide into about two, lie in the left and right sides of the door body respectively. So, further protect the door body through reducing the area of contact between middle cushion and the door body, reduce the impact that the door body received in the transportation.
For the existing embedded kitchen appliance, gaps for heat dissipation are generally reserved between the outer side face of the kitchen appliance and a wall body or a cabinet body, in order to shield the gaps, the attractiveness is improved, the width of the door body is slightly larger than that of the shell, the left side and the right side of the door body are exposed out of the left side and the right side of the shell, the door body of the structure is convexly arranged outside the shell, so that the door body is more easily damaged in the transportation process, in order to protect the door body of the structure, furthermore, the horizontal section of each middle cushion block is U-shaped, and the side part of the door body, which is exposed out of the shell, is inserted into the groove of the middle cushion block.
Furthermore, the middle cushion block is arranged corresponding to the corner of the lower cushion block and is abutted against the inner corner of the outer packing box.
Furthermore, the door bodies are movable doors capable of moving back and forth, and a handle extending along the left and right directions of the door bodies is convexly arranged on the front side surface of each door body; the middle cushion block is provided with a slot for inserting the handle; the middle cushion block is limited on the handle of the door body through the slot. So, when the cooperation of middle cushion and handle makes middle cushion can protect the door body better, can also make middle cushion support on hand, and need not to support on cushion down, reduced the package material quantity of middle cushion.
In order to further solve the second technical problem, it is preferable that the bottom surface of the door body located at the lowermost position is exposed below the bottom surface of the casing, and the top surface of the door body located at the uppermost position is exposed above the top surface of the casing; the top surface of the lower cushion block is also provided with a first shell clamping groove which can allow the bottom surface of the shell to be inserted into the first shell clamping groove, and the bottom surface of the upper cushion block is also provided with a second shell clamping groove which can allow the top surface of the shell to be inserted into the second shell clamping groove.
Preferably, at least two horizontal support bars are arranged on the bottom surface of the first shell clamping groove along the circumferential edge, the support bars are arranged on the side where the first door body clamping groove is avoided, a first pit is formed by the support bars and the bottom surface of the first shell clamping groove in an enclosing manner, the bottom surface of the shell is supported on the support bars, and a gap is formed between the support bars and the first pit;
and/or at least two horizontal limiting strips are arranged on the top surface of the second shell clamping groove along the circumferential edge, the limiting strips are arranged on one side where the second door body clamping groove is avoided, a second pit is formed by the limiting strips and the top surface of the second shell clamping groove in a surrounding mode, the top surface of the shell is in contact with the limiting strips, and a gap is formed between the top surface of the shell and the second pit. In this manner, the stronger, least deformable edge of the shell is supported between the upper and lower pads; the middle of the top surface or the bottom surface of the shell is a weak part which is easy to deform, and the weak part can be effectively protected from being damaged by suspension placement of the weak part.
In order to improve the limit buffering of the shell, a first right angle capable of surrounding the lower corner part of the shell corresponding to the lower corner part of the shell is arranged on the first shell clamping groove; and a second right angle capable of surrounding the upper corner part is arranged on the second shell clamping groove corresponding to the upper corner part of the shell.
In the scheme, the end faces of the upper cushion block and/or the lower cushion block are hollowed to form a trample prevention structure. And (3) arranging the two packed sample machines together, walking five times on the tested sample machine by a person with the weight of about 70 +/-10 kg, and walking the tested sample machine for the total retention time of (30 +/-3) s. After the test, the structure of the outer packing box has no unacceptable damage and deformation, and the fixture in the box has no falling off. Directly having saved protective material such as lumber skid, wooden frame that generally adopts in the current packing, greatly alleviateed the cost, reduced the packing degree of difficulty, be favorable to production efficiency's promotion.
And the top surface of the upper cushion block is provided with a containing groove for placing a power line plug. Therefore, the problem that the existing power line is easy to fall off due to the fact that the power line is adhered to the back face of the shell through the adhesive tape is solved.
Finally, the kitchen appliance is a disinfection cabinet.
Compared with the prior art, the invention has the advantages that: through set up middle cushion on the basis of upper and lower cushion, middle cushion can carry on spacingly to the at least adjacent part of two adjacent door bodies, and then at last, the bottom cushion carries on spacingly to the top that is located the door body of the top and is located the bottom of the door body of below, middle cushion can also carry on spacingly to the middle door body, and then can effectively protect each door body, make each door body can obtain effectual spacing and buffering when receiving vibrations or falling, the condition of the door body unevenness or even breakage is avoided appearing.
The packaging assembly disclosed by the invention is simple in structure, can effectively protect the door body of the kitchen appliance, and can well protect the shell of the kitchen appliance, so that corners and other vulnerable parts of the shell are prevented from being damaged.

Detailed Description
The invention is described in further detail below with reference to the accompanying examples.
The first embodiment is as follows:
as shown in fig. 1 to 10, a first preferred embodiment of a packaging assembly for kitchen appliances according to the present invention includes an outer packaging box 1, and an inner packaging assembly accommodated in the outer packaging box 1, wherein the inner packaging assembly includes a lower cushion block 2, an upper cushion block 3 located above the lower cushion block 2, and a middle cushion block 5 located between the upper cushion block and the lower cushion block, and an accommodating space for accommodating a kitchen appliance 4 is formed between the upper cushion block 3, the lower cushion block 2, and the middle cushion block 5; the upper cushion block 3 is arranged corresponding to the opening surface 11 of the outer packing box 1, and the outer contour formed among the upper cushion block 3, the lower cushion block 2 and the middle cushion block 5 is matched with the inner wall contour of the outer packing box 1 and is abutted with the inner wall contour; the kitchen appliance 4 is a disinfection cabinet, and comprises a square shell 41, a chamber is arranged in the shell 41, the front side of the shell 41 is provided with an opening and two door bodies 42 which are distributed up and down and used for opening and closing the opening; the door body 42 is a glass sliding door capable of moving forward and backward, and the left side and the right side of the door body 42 are exposed out of the left side and the right side of the shell 41; the bottom surface of the lower door 42 is exposed below the bottom surface of the casing 41, and the top surface of the upper door 42 is exposed above the top surface of the casing 41.
As shown in fig. 3, 4, and 10, in order to further protect the door bodies 42 and prevent the door bodies from being uneven and even broken between the upper and lower door bodies, two middle cushion blocks 5 are provided, and are respectively located at the connection positions of the left and right sides of the door body 42 and the casing 41, and are used for simultaneously limiting the adjacent portions of two adjacent door bodies 42, the horizontal section of each middle cushion block 5 is in a horizontal U shape, and the inner side wall thereof is provided with a groove 51 into which the side portion of the door body 42 exposed out of the casing 41 can be inserted; the middle cushion block 5 is arranged corresponding to the corner of the lower cushion block 2, supported on the lower cushion block 2 and abutted against the inner corner of the outer packing box 1.
As shown in fig. 6 and 9, a first housing slot 211 capable of accommodating the bottom surface of the housing 41 inserted therein and a first door slot 212 capable of accommodating the bottom surface of the door 42 located below inserted therein are formed on the top surface of the lower cushion block 2, and the first housing slot 211 is communicated with the first door slot 212, so that the bottom surface of the kitchen appliance 4 is clamped downwards in the first slot 21. In order to improve the supporting strength of the lower cushion block 2 to the casing 41, three horizontal supporting bars 22 are arranged on the bottom surface of the first casing clamping groove 211 along the circumferential edge, one side, where the supporting bar 22 avoids the first door body clamping groove 212, is arranged on the other three sides of the first casing clamping groove 211, a first concave pit 23 is formed between the supporting bar 22 and the bottom surface of the first casing clamping groove 211 in a surrounding manner, and a gap is formed between the bottom surface of the casing 41 and the first concave pit 23. Meanwhile, the lower corner of the first housing slot 211 corresponding to the housing 41 has a first right angle 24 capable of surrounding the lower corner, so as to buffer and limit the lower corner of the housing 41. In order to further improve the protection of the disinfection cabinet, four corners of the lower cushion block 2 are protruded upwards, wherein the first door body clamping groove 212 is formed between two corners positioned at the front side of the lower cushion block 2, and the first right angle 24 is formed inside two corners positioned at the rear side of the lower cushion block 2. The protruding bight of establishing on lower cushion 2 and the position between two adjacent bights form a difference in height, form high low order spacing buffer structure, and is more comprehensive to the protection of sterilizer.
As shown in fig. 7, a second housing slot 311 capable of allowing the top surface of the housing 41 to be inserted therein and a second door body slot 312 capable of allowing the top surface of the door body 42 located above to be inserted therein are formed in the bottom surface of the upper cushion block 3, and the second housing slot 311 is communicated with the second door body slot 312. In order to improve the protection strength of the upper cushion block 3 and the shell 41, two horizontal limiting strips 32 are arranged on the top surface of the second shell clamping groove 311 along the circumferential edges, one side of the limiting strip 32, which avoids the second door body clamping groove 312, is arranged on the left side and the right side of the second shell clamping groove 311, a second concave pit 33 is formed by enclosing the limiting strip 32 and the top surface of the second shell clamping groove 311, and the top surface of the shell 41 is in contact with the limiting strip 32 and forms a gap with the second concave pit 33. Similarly, the second housing slot 311 has a second right angle 34 capable of surrounding the upper corner of the housing 41 corresponding to the upper corner of the housing 41, so as to limit the upper corner of the housing 41. In order to further improve the protection of the disinfection cabinet, four corners of the upper block 3 are protruded downward, wherein the second door body locking groove 312 is formed between two corners located at the front side of the upper block 3, and the second right angle 34 is formed inside two corners located at the rear side of the upper block 3. The part between the corner part convexly arranged on the upper cushion block 3 and the two adjacent corner parts forms a height difference to form a high-low order limiting buffer structure. Meanwhile, in order to carry the outer packing box 1 conveniently, handle holes 12 are formed in the left side and the right side of the outer packing box 1, handle supporting structures 36 are arranged on the left side and the right side of the upper cushion block 3 corresponding to the handle holes 12, and therefore the contact area between the palm and the packing component is increased. Meanwhile, the top surface of the upper cushion block 3 is provided with a containing groove 35 for placing a power line plug, and the power line plug can be directly inserted into the containing groove 35 so as to prevent the power line connector from falling off to damage the disinfection cabinet.
The package assembly in this embodiment can stack, and the terminal surface fretwork of going up cushion 3 and lower cushion 2 forms prevents trampling the structure, can effectively protect the sterilizer.
The disinfection cabinet of the embodiment adopts the following packaging steps:
1. opening the opening surface 11 of the outer packing box 1, placing the top surface of the lower cushion block 2 upwards to the inner bottom of the outer packing box 1, wherein the outer packing box 1 adopts a corrugated carton;
2. after being sleeved with a packaging bag, the disinfection cabinet is placed on the lower cushion block 2, so that the bottom of the shell 41 of the disinfection cabinet is inserted into the first shell clamping groove 211, and the bottom of the door body 42 is inserted into the first door body clamping groove 212;
3. the middle cushion blocks 5 are stuffed into the outer packing box 1 along the left side and the right side of the door body 42 of the disinfection cabinet;
4. the bottom surface of the upper cushion block 3 is placed on the top surface of the disinfection cabinet downwards, so that the top of the shell 41 of the disinfection cabinet is inserted into the second shell clamping groove 311, and the top of the door body 42 is inserted into the second door body clamping groove 312;
5. closing the opening surface 11 of the outer packaging box 1, and sealing the outer packaging box 1 by using adhesive tapes, box sealing nails, packing belts and the like to finish the packaging process, thus obtaining the structure shown in figure 1.
Example two:
as shown in fig. 11, a second preferred embodiment of the packaging assembly for kitchen appliances of the present invention is basically the same as the first embodiment, except that a handle 43 extending along the left-right direction of the door body 42 is convexly disposed on the front side of each door body 42; the middle cushion block 5 is provided with a slot 52 for inserting a handle; the middle cushion block 5 is limited on the handle 43 of the door body 42 through the slot 52 and is separated from the lower cushion block 2.
